titleOfInvention A kind of green nitration technology prepares DNFB
abstract The invention discloses a kind of method that green nitration technology prepares 2,4 dinitrofluorobenzene.This method is using dinitrogen pentoxide/nitric acid as nitrification system, using parachloronitrobenzene as raw material, prepares 2,4 dinitrofluorobenzene.When parachloronitrobenzene is 5 grams, the reaction time is 70 minutes, and reaction temperature is 50 DEG C, and dinitrogen pentoxide concentration is 0.3 grams per milliliter (3 grams of dinitrogen pentoxide, 10 milliliters of nitric acid), now, and the yield of 2,4 dinitrofluorobenzene is 96.73%, purity 100%.
